4) All of your organ systems work together to provide a stable environment for the life of your cells. This stable environment is known as _?_.

Question

  1. All of your organ systems work together to provide a stable environment for the life of your cells. This stable environment is known as ?.
🧐 Not the exact question you are looking for?Go ask a question

Solution

The stable environment that all of your organ systems work together to provide for the life of your cells is known as homeostasis.
